No receivable was recognized as of March 29, 2026 due to uncertainty regarding the realizability of the refund. During the thirteen weeks ended June 28, 2026, MasterBrand received $1.2 million of refunds (excluding $0.1 million of interest) and recognized this amount as a reduction in cost of products sold. No receivable has been recognized as of June 28, 2026 for the remaining $13.7 million of IEEPA tariffs paid prior to the Supreme Court decision due to uncertainty regarding the realizability of the refund. Subsequent to June 28, 2026, MasterBrand received $9.2 million of refunds (excluding $0.4 million of interest) and will recognize this amount, as well as any additional refunds subsequently collected during our fiscal third quarter of 2026, as a reduction in cost of products sold during the thirteen weeks ending September 27, 2026.
